Web2. Create opportunities for collaboration. A key component of building a cohort-based course is emphasizing the value of collaboration. Unlike a self-paced course where members work through pre-made lessons on their own time, a cohort is centered around helping people solve problems as a group. WebJul 11, 2024 · In an online course, you have to consciously build in these “outside” spaces that are free from content delivery and assessment. Make “water cooler” or “café” discussion boards where the class can talk about current events and common interests. Create a social media page for the class where ideas can be shared. WebA perfect match: community and cohort-based courses. Cohort-based courses, or “CBCs” for short, take this idea one step further. In CBCs, creators guide a group, or cohort, through a course together at the same time. They also have a couple of key differences to standard self-paced courses.
